tips for MRCP
welcome fellow mrcp candidates i passed mrcp part one and 2 first time
with good score. and this is my advice to you
1- study from a small book not from big text book and the best
one in my opinion is oxford handbook of clinical medicine
because when i started prepairing for mrcp part one i
studied from different sources including this but when i
finished my exam i was surprised that i found all the answers
for the exam questions from this small book so i concentrated
on studing from this book in my study for part two and i got even higher score.
2- do at least one online mrcp course like onexamination or
pastest course because i found these courses much more valuable
than bof books and usually contains a lot of questions from
previous exams and many of these questions tend to be repeated
on the next exams and actually i personally know other candidates
who only studied online courses and still passed first time.
3 donot be tempted to study from books specially made for mrcp
as i find these books to have a lot of inaccurate information.
4-try to cover all branches and topics evenly in your study.
for example donot study hard in cardiology and leve some other
branch like nephrology not well coverd because in this way you
will miss so many easy questions in nephrology and still will
not get all cardiology questions right.
5- donot overlook small branches like ophthalmology, statistics,
and psychiatry because you will be able to collect a
lot of marks from this branches in only short period period of study.
